Report reveals release clause in Ito’s Stuttgart contract

By Rune Gjerulff   @runegjerulff

Sky Germany reports that Hiroki Ito has a release clause in his contract with VfB Stuttgart.

Ito pens new deal with Stuttgart

When Hiroki Ito extended his contract with VfB Stuttgart until 2027 in August, a release clause was reportedly inserted into the deal.


According to Sky Germany, the Japanese centre-back can leave the club for €30 million via the release clause.

However, a move this winter is unlikely as Ito wants to finish the season with Stuttgart, according to the report.

The 24-year-old recently picked up an injury that will sideline him for the rest of the year.
